Image slimming for Ferroline builds. Base images now use the trimmed runtime layer; no shell, no package manager in prod stages. Result: ~60% size cut, faster pulls. Rules: multi-stage builds mandatory, pin digests, strip debug symbols, no dev deps in final layer. CI blocks images over 400MB. Exceptions need sign-off from the platform lead. Release manager checklist: verify digest pins and size gate before tagging. The slimming policy, allowed base list, and waiver process are documented on this page.

wiki page, tahaf-tajog: https://jira.ordindyn.corp/pipeline

Night-shift access — Support team

Support staff on the night rota at Tellbury Wharf enter via the side lobby only; the main entrance locks at 21:00. No visitors after hours without prior written approval from the duty manager. Escort any approved visitor at all times and log arrival and departure at the desk. Badge in at every reader, even when doors are held. The side-lobby keypad uses the code below.

staff pass of kawip-hawef = bdg-QLP-2

Release checklist — Nightbridge Backfill Scheduler. Before promoting a release, confirm the scheduler's cron window still avoids the warehouse maintenance slot, verify the dry-run completes against the staging dataset, and check that retry budgets are unchanged from the prior tag. New folks: never skip the dry-run, even for config-only changes. Record your sign-off alongside the build token printed below.

session token of yajof-bagef = htk4_937d

Ticket BRM-412: Cold starts exceed 6s on Fennelgate handlers

Repro steps:
1. Leave the `receipt-render` function idle 20 minutes.
2. Invoke via the Lanthorn gateway.
3. Observe first response takes 6–9s; warm calls take ~180ms.

Suspect the oversized dependency bundle. Profiling endpoint is gated, so when reproducing, call it with the bearer token below.

session JWT of yawep-yawep = eyJhbGciOiJIUzI1NiIsInR5cCI6IkpXVCJ9.eyJzdWIiOiI3pWF3_In0.aXYsHiog